Boing Boing: Eliminating bank clocks in attempt to reduce complaints

Customers at NatWest banks have been complaining about the time wasted waiting in long lines. The bank’s response? Get rid of the clocks on the walls.
I bet it works, perhaps even better than speeding up the lines would have worked. You have to design around humans’ perceptions of reality, sometimes in opposition to “objective” reality. (via Boing Boing)
